Samson Spider Farmer SE5000 Dimmable Full Spectrum LED Grow Light New - SE-5000
MAXIMUM UNIFORMITY & EFFICIENCY: Unique designed 6-LED bars provide more even canopy coverage, especially to the outer edges of cultivation areas. With 2016pcs SAMSUNG LM301 diodes, SE5000 Led grow lights draw 480 watts with 1317.4umol/s, achieving an impressive PPE of 2.75 umol/J, coverage for 4’x4′ of high-yielding full-cycle growth.

Maintenance Tips
-
Keep drivers & heat sinks dust-free: Dust buildup reduces cooling efficiency and can shorten diode lifespan. Clean with a dry brush or air blower.
-
Maintain proper airflow: Even though it has passive cooling, ensure good tent/room ventilation to prevent heat stress.
-
Avoid full power at all stages: Use dimming during seedling/early veg to reduce stress and extend diode life.
-
Check hanging height regularly: Maintain correct distance from canopy to avoid light burn or uneven PPFD distribution.
-
Secure wiring & connections: Ensure AC input and dimming/control cables are tightly connected to avoid flicker or driver damage.
-
Stable power source: Use a surge protector or regulated power line—high-watt LED drivers are sensitive to voltage spikes.
-
Clean reflectors/bar lenses gently: Use microfiber cloth only—no alcohol sprays directly on LEDs.
-
Avoid humidity exposure on driver: Driver is detachable—keep it outside high-humidity zones in grow tents.
-
Inspect periodically: Check for flickering, uneven bar output, or fanless heat buildup changes (early warning signs of driver wear).
